Automated Information Extraction: Digital Scraping, Parsing, and Discovery Pipelines
Automating the collection of information from the internet has become ever more important for businesses and researchers alike. This is often achieved through a series of connected steps – a pipeline involving web scraping to initially gather the raw information, followed by parsing to structure it into a usable form, and finally, data mining or discovery to extract valuable trends. These machine-driven pipelines can significantly reduce the effort demanded to secure large quantities of data, freeing up human staff for more critical tasks. Navigating HTML to Data: Becoming XPath for Web Scraping
Web scraping can feel like searching for needles in a digital maze of HTML, but XPath offers a surprisingly elegant solution. Instead of relying on fragile markers that quickly break with website redesigns, XPath enables you to precisely pinpoint elements based on their structural relationships within the document. Learning XPath transforms raw HTML into valuable data, paving the way for automated data gathering and powerful analysis. Grasping Web Harvesting Basics: Document Processing & Navigation Techniques
At the foundation of most web scraping endeavors lies the ability to effectively parse document structure. This involves dissecting the formatting into a usable format. Once structured, the real power comes from navigation – a query tool that allows you to precisely find specific components within the document. You can think of XPath as a advanced way to move through the document tree, selecting accurately the information you need. Understanding these two fundamentals – HTML parsing and XPath traversal – is essential for any budding web harvester.
